Geek Squad broke my laptop? by Alternative-Jicama90 in GeekSquad

[–]HuskyTox86 0 points1 point  (0 children)

At minimum, it sounds like hardware. From what I read, it sounds like they attempted an OS Restore and the issue is still persistent. Now that your PC has a fresh image on it, nothing works because the issue isn't with the OS (That's why it seems worse than before). I don't see where they replaced the drive, so it may possibly be a bad drive. If a bad drive continues to be used, it can make existing issues worse. Tech problems don't stay static.

Did they offer to replace the drive? If not, that should've been one of their troubleshoots; Otherwise, yeah, if it's still under a warranty or protection plan I would go that route to get it fixed if they confirmed it's a mobo issue.

I think im cooked.. Pulled charging port/cable on Ipad7, is it ruined? by TheHighestTemplar in GeekSquad

[–]HuskyTox86 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Short answer: Yeah, it's cooked.

It looks like some of the contacts came off when the two pieces disconnected. The QR serial tells me that is a module that can be replaced, but if it follows the same pricing as iPhone parts, you are basically replacing the entire thing at that point (Logic boards are super expensive).
